Impact of split nitrogen applications on nitrate leaching and maize yield in irrigated loamy sand soils of Northeast Nebraska

Arshdeep Singh,
Daran Rudnick,
Daniel D. Snow
et al.

Abstract: Little information is available on optimizing the number of nitrogen (N) splits based on nitrate (NO3‐N) leaching and maize yield in sandy soils. To address this gap, we evaluated the impact of multiple N splits (2‐, 3‐, 4‐, and 5‐N splits) on NO3‐N leaching and maize (Zea mays L.) grain yield in irrigated loamy sand soil at a producer site in the Bazile Groundwater Management Area of Northeast Nebraska.
